Google Jobs Requirements: What It Takes to Land a Job at Google
Google seeks candidates with strong technical skills, relevant experience, and soft skills like communication and teamwork.
Most roles require a bachelorâs degree or equivalent practical experience, but specific requirements vary by position.
The hiring process is competitive, with less than 1% of applicants accepted, emphasizing preparation and cultural fit.
International candidates can apply, but visa and language requirements may apply depending on the role.
Landing a job at Google is a dream for many, but it requires meeting specific qualifications tailored to the role youâre targeting. From software engineering to marketing, Googleâs job requirements focus on a blend of technical expertise, practical experience, and interpersonal skills. Understanding these expectations can help you craft a standout application.
Education: A bachelorâs degree in a relevant field is often required, though equivalent practical experience (e.g., internships, personal projects) is accepted for many roles.
Experience: Varies by role, typically 2â5 years for entry-level to mid-level positions.
Skills: Technical roles demand proficiency in programming, while non-technical roles prioritize communication, analytical skills, and industry knowledge.
Cultural Fit: Google values âGoogleynessââtraits like creativity, adaptability, and alignment with their mission to organize the worldâs information.
To meet Googleâs job requirements, tailor your resume to highlight relevant skills, practice coding or role-specific tasks, and research Googleâs culture. International candidates should verify visa eligibility and language requirements for their desired location.
Comprehensive Guide to Google Jobs Requirements
Landing a job at Google is a dream for many international job seekers, engineers, and students. Known for its innovative culture, cutting-edge technology, and attractive perks, Google attracts top talent globally. However, with millions of applicants each year and an acceptance rate of less than 1%, securing a position is highly competitive. This guide explores the specific Google job requirements, outlines the hiring process, and provides actionable tips to help you stand out. Whether youâre a fresh graduate or an experienced professional, understanding what Google looks for can set you on the path to success.
1. Understanding Googleâs Hiring Process
Before diving into Google jobs requirements, itâs crucial to understand Googleâs structured, data-driven hiring process, designed to identify top talent.
1.1 Application Submission
Create a Careers Profile: Visit Google Careers to set up a profile and upload your resume (under 2 MB).
Optional Components: Include education, work history, and a cover letter to strengthen your application.
Job Selection: Browse listings and apply for up to three roles every 30 days, ensuring alignment with your skills.
1.2 Screening and Interviews
Initial Screening: Recruiters review applications to shortlist candidates based on qualifications.
Interviews: Expect multiple rounds, including:
Phone or video screenings to assess basic skills.
Technical interviews for engineering roles, focusing on coding and system design.
Behavioral interviews to evaluate cultural fit and soft skills.
Team Matching: Successful candidates are paired with a team that matches their expertise.
Offer: An offer is extended, followed by onboarding.
2. Job Requirements by Role
Google offers diverse roles, each with specific Google job requirements. Below are the qualifications for key positions.
Bachelorâs degree in computer science or related field, or equivalent practical experience.
2â5 years of software development experience in languages like Python, Java, C++, or Go.
Proficiency in data structures (e.g., arrays, trees) and algorithms (e.g., sorting, searching).
Preferred Qualifications:
Masterâs or PhD in Computer Science.
Experience with distributed systems or large-scale infrastructure.
Contributions to open-source projects or personal coding portfolios.
Example: A Software Engineer III role in Bengaluru requires 2 years of coding experience or 1 year with an advanced degree, plus expertise in data structures (Google Careers).
2.2 Product Management Roles
Bachelorâs degree in any field.
Experience in product development or management.
Preferred Qualifications:
Strong analytical and communication skills.
Knowledge of user experience design and market trends.
Ability to make data-driven decisions.
2.3 Marketing and Sales Roles
Bachelorâs degree in marketing, business, or related field.
2â5 years of experience in digital marketing, advertising, or sales.
Preferred Qualifications:
Familiarity with Googleâs products (e.g., Google Ads, Cloud).
Multilingual skills for international roles (e.g., English and Thai for a Bangkok position).
Strong negotiation and interpersonal skills.
Example: A senior account manager in Dublin needs 5 years of experience in advertising and fluency in English and Hebrew.
Finance: Bachelorâs degree in finance or accounting; experience in financial analysis.
People Operations (HR): Bachelorâs degree in HR or business; expertise in talent acquisition or employee engagement.
Table: Role-Specific Requirements
3. Technical Skills Required
Technical roles at Google demand specific skills to tackle complex projects.
Programming Languages: Proficiency in Python, Java, C++, Go, or JavaScript.
Data Structures and Algorithms: Deep understanding of arrays, trees, graphs, and sorting algorithms.
System Design: Ability to design scalable systems, such as a messaging app or URL shortener.
Problem-Solving: Analytical skills to address real-world challenges.
Preparation Tip: Practice coding on platforms like LeetCode or HackerRank to meet Googleâs technical expectations.
4. Soft Skills Google Values
Googleâs Project Aristotle highlights the importance of soft skills in successful teams, making them a critical part of Google job requirements.
Communication: Articulate ideas clearly in interviews and team settings.
Teamwork: Collaborate effectively in cross-functional teams.
Leadership: Lead projects or initiatives, even without a formal title.
Problem-Solving: Approach challenges with creativity and critical thinking.
Adaptability: Learn new technologies and adapt to change.
Creativity: Develop innovative solutions to complex problems.
Emotional Intelligence: Show empathy and manage team dynamics.
Googleyness: Align with Googleâs values, such as âFocus on the userâ and âThink big,â reflecting open-mindedness and intellectual courage.
How to Showcase Soft Skills:
Resume: Highlight teamwork or leadership in past projects (e.g., âLed a team to launch a mobile app with 50,000 usersâ).
Interviews: Use the STAR method (Situation, Task, Action, Result) to demonstrate these traits.
5. Preparing Your Application
A standout application is your first step to meeting Googleâs requirements.
Keep it concise (1â2 pages).
Use action verbs (e.g., âdeveloped,â âoptimizedâ).
Quantify achievements (e.g., âImproved app performance by 20%â).
Include relevant projects, internships, or open-source contributions.
Personalize it to the role and Googleâs mission.
Share your passion for innovation and how your skills align.
Example: Ahmed, a product manager from Egypt, tailored his resume to highlight launching a mobile app, earning him a Google interview.
Googleâs interviews test technical and soft skills rigorously.
Practice medium-to-hard coding problems on LeetCode.
Study system design for senior roles (e.g., designing a scalable system).
Prepare STAR-based answers for questions like âTell me about a time you solved a complex problem.â
Reflect Googleâs values in your responses.
Case Study: Priya, an Indian computer science student, secured a Google internship by practicing 100+ LeetCode problems and sharing a hackathon leadership story during her behavioral interview.
Real-world examples illustrate how candidates meet Google job requirements.
Maria, Software Engineer (Brazil): Maria emphasized her open-source contributions and aced coding interviews, landing a role at Googleâs Mountain View office.
Ahmed, Product Manager (Egypt): Ahmedâs resume showcased a successful app launch, aligning with Googleâs user-centric focus, earning him a product management role.
8.1 Do I need a degree to work at Google?
While many roles prefer a bachelorâs or masterâs degree, Google accepts equivalent practical experience, such as professional projects or internships.
8.2 How long does Googleâs hiring process take?
The process typically takes 4â8 weeks, including application review, interviews, and team matching. International candidates may face longer timelines due to visa processing.
8.3 Can international candidates apply?
Yes, Google hires globally, but candidates must verify visa and work authorization requirements for their target location. Some roles require specific language skills.
9. Conclusion and Action Plan
Meeting Google jobs' requirements demands technical expertise, soft skills, and strategic preparation. By understanding role-specific qualifications, tailoring your application, and excelling in interviews, you can boost your chances of joining Google. Persistence is keyâmany Googlers applied multiple times before succeeding.
Research Roles: Explore Google Careers for 2â3 suitable positions.
Update Resume: Highlight achievements and relevant projects.
Practice Skills: Code on LeetCode or prepare role-specific tasks.
Prepare for Interviews: Use STAR for behavioral questions and practice technical problems.
Apply: Submit your application and follow up professionally.
Ready to pursue your dream job at Google? Share your questions or experiences in the comments below! Subscribe to our newsletter for more career tips, or download our free âGoogle Interview Prep Checklistâ to stay organized. Start your journey today!